1. Overheating Motors
Signs and symptoms: The motor comes to be excessively hot during operation, potentially bring about an automated shutdown or lowered efficiency.
Causes: Overheating can be as a result of overuse, bearing friction, or blocked air vents. Bring loads larger than the advised ability or continually riding uphill can worry the motor.
Solutions: Make sure the motor is not blocked by debris and has sufficient ventilation. On a regular basis clean the motor housing and change any type of used bearings. Prevent extended use at maximum power and abide by the producer s weight recommendations.

2. Lowered Power or Performance
Signs: The skateboard does not increase as quickly as it used to or has a hard time to preserve rate.
Reasons: This could be as a result of a stopping working battery, worn-out components, or a misaligned belt in belt-driven motors.
Solutions: Check the battery wellness and replace it if essential. For belt-driven systems, inspect the belt for wear and correct tension, and readjust or change it as required. Maintain the motor tidy and make sure all links are safe and secure.

3. Motor Sound
Symptoms: Uncommon seem like grinding, clicking, or yawping coming from the motor location.
Reasons: Sounds are typically triggered by loose components, imbalance, debris within the motor, or birthing concerns.

Solutions: Tighten all parts and make sure the motor place is protected. Clear out any kind of debris and check the motor equipments and belt (if appropriate) for wear. If the bearings are harmed or unclean, they need to be cleaned up or replaced.

4. Motor Does Not Involve
Signs and symptoms: The motor does not reply to the throttle or seems to have difficulty engaging.

Solutions: Inspect all electrical connections for signs of wear or damages. Ensure the ESC is working correctly and the remote is appropriately paired to the skateboard. In some cases, resetting the system can resolve engagement concerns.

5. Water Damage
Signs and symptoms: Motor efficiency problems after direct exposure to water, consisting of loss of power or failure to begin.
Reasons: Although lots of electrical skateboard motors are advertised as water-resistant, extended or significant exposure to water can cause damage.
Solutions: Avoid riding in wet conditions. If the motor has actually been revealed to water, quickly shut off the skateboard, separate the battery, and allow the motor to completely dry completely prior to trying to utilize it again. For water inside the motor, it may call for disassembly and thorough drying out.

6. Battery Connection Concerns
Symptoms: Recurring power or motor cut-outs throughout usage.
Reasons: Loosened or rusty battery links can disrupt the power flow to the motor.
Solutions: Examine the battery terminals and connectors for rust or looseness. Clean any kind of corrosion with a remedy of baking soda and water, and guarantee all links are limited.

7. ESC Failings
Symptoms: Abrupt loss of power, failure to control speed, or erratic motor behavior.
Reasons: The ESC may malfunction because of overheating, damages, or firmware issues.
Solutions: Ensure the ESC is not overheating by checking its temperature level throughout use. Secure it from particles and dampness. Check for any type of firmware updates from the manufacturer, which could deal with digital glitches.

8. Deterioration
Signs: Steady decrease in motor performance or boosted noise throughout operation.
Causes: Normal wear and tear can degrade motor elements gradually, impacting efficiency.
Solutions: Normal maintenance, including cleaning, lubrication, and substitute of used components, can expand the life of the motor. Watch on the problem of the belts, bearings, and equipments, and replace them as required.

Upkeep Tips for Preventing Issues:

Routine Cleansing: Keep the motor and its parts devoid of dust and particles.
Correct Storage Space: Store your electrical skateboard in a dry, warm environment to avoid exposure to wetness and severe temperature levels.
Routine Evaluations: Routinely examine the motor and related parts for wear, ensuring every little thing is limited and lined up.
Battery Care: Preserve the battery according to the producer s directions, and shop it properly to stay clear of destruction.
Firmware Updates: Keep the skateboard s firmware updated to guarantee all electronic components function efficiently.
